Where Fire Risk Really Starts in Industrial Spaces

Unlike office buildings, warehouses and factories are dynamic environments. Fire risks are not static they evolve with operations, inventory, and processes. Understanding this context is key to recognizing why fire watch services are necessary.

Common fire risk factors include:

  • Storage of flammable goods like chemicals, textiles, or packaging materials

  • Electrical overload from machinery and temporary wiring

  • Heat-generating processes such as welding, cutting, or grinding

  • Dust accumulation in manufacturing environments (especially in woodworking or grain facilities)

  • Blocked or compromised fire exits and suppression systems

These conditions don’t always trigger immediate alarms, which is why relying solely on automated detection can create blind spots. Fire risk monitoring in such spaces requires continuous observation and quick human judgment something technology alone cannot fully provide.

What Fire Watch Services Actually Mean in Practice

At its core, a fire watch involves trained personnel actively monitoring a facility for signs of fire hazards, especially when fire protection systems are impaired or when risk levels are elevated. In warehouses and factories, this role becomes highly specialized.

Fire watch guards are responsible for:

  • Conducting regular patrols across high-risk zones

  • Identifying early signs of fire, such as unusual heat, smoke, or sparks

  • Ensuring fire exits, extinguishers, and hydrants are accessible

  • Maintaining detailed logs of observations and incidents

  • Initiating emergency procedures and contacting fire services when needed

This isn’t passive observation. It is structured, accountable oversight designed to detect problems before they become emergencies.

When Warehouses and Factories Require Fire Watch

Fire watch requirements are not optional in many situations they are mandated by safety standards and enforced by fire authorities. Industrial facilities often encounter multiple scenarios where fire watch becomes necessary.

During System Failures

If fire alarms, sprinklers, or suppression systems are down due to malfunction or maintenance, fire watch services must be implemented immediately. Without them, the facility is operating without its primary defense mechanism.

During Hot Work Operations

Activities like welding or cutting introduce ignition sources into environments that may contain combustible materials. Fire watch is typically required both during and after such operations to monitor for delayed ignition.

During Construction or Renovation

Temporary changes to layout, wiring, and access points increase fire risk. Dust, debris, and exposed systems further complicate safety. Fire watch ensures continuous monitoring during these transitional phases.

During Power Outages

A loss of power can disable alarms and detection systems. In warehouses where operations may continue even during outages, emergency fire watch becomes essential to maintain safety.

Compliance: Why Fire Watch Is a Regulatory Requirement

Fire safety compliance in industrial environments is governed by standards such as those set by OSHA and NFPA, along with local fire marshal regulations. These frameworks recognize that systems can fail or be temporarily unavailable and they require compensatory measures.

Key compliance expectations include:

  • Continuous monitoring when fire protection systems are impaired

  • Documentation of patrols and incident logs

  • Immediate reporting of hazards or fire-related incidents

  • Proper training and certification of fire watch personnel

Failure to meet these requirements can result in fines, shutdown orders, or liability in the event of an incident. Fire watch services are not just a safety measure they are a compliance obligation.

Real-World Example: Manufacturing Facility Under Maintenance

A mid-sized manufacturing plant scheduled maintenance for its sprinkler system, requiring a temporary shutdown. During this period, production continued to meet deadlines. Recognizing the increased risk, the facility implemented fire watch services across all operational zones.

Within hours, a fire watch guard identified overheating in a machine due to a cooling system malfunction. The issue was addressed before it could ignite surrounding materials. Without fire watch, this incident could have escalated into a full-scale fire, especially with the sprinkler system offline.

This example highlights how fire watch services function as a proactive safeguard, not just a reactive measure.

Integrating Fire Watch into a Broader Safety Strategy

Fire watch should not be viewed as a standalone solution. It works best when integrated into a comprehensive fire safety plan that includes:

  • Regular system inspections and maintenance

  • Employee training on fire prevention and response

  • Clear evacuation procedures

  • Risk assessments tailored to specific operations

When combined, these elements create a layered defense system where fire watch acts as the human link bridging gaps in technology and process.
